An automatic gate is a machine that moves several hundred pounds of steel across a space people and vehicles occupy, and almost everything that goes wrong with one traces back to a specification made from the wrong number. The number most commonly used is the opening width, because it is the easiest to obtain over the phone. The numbers that actually matter are the weight of the leaf, its leverage about the hinge, and how many times a day it will run. An operator chosen from width alone is a coin toss.

We take those measurements before recommending anything. That means establishing the leaf weight, checking whether the gate is square and rigid enough to be driven at all, confirming the footings will take cycling loads rather than only static ones, and asking how the property actually uses the gate. A gate serving eight units is a commercial-duty application even though the building is residential, and specifying it as residential guarantees an early failure.

Choosing and Sizing the Operator

Installer feeding operator cable from a spool into the conduit at a gate operator

Matching the Operator to the Leaf

Every operator carries a rated leaf weight and width, and those ratings assume a gate that is square, freely moving and correctly hung. We measure against them with margin rather than to the limit, because a unit run permanently at the top of its rating has no reserve for a windy day, a stiffening hinge or a gate that has picked up a slight drag. Sizing with headroom costs a little more once and saves the cost of replacing a burnt-out operator and everything downstream of it.

UL 325 Duty Classes

UL 325 classifies operators by application: Class I for single-family residential, Class II for multi-family and commercial with general access, Class III for commercial and industrial with limited access, and Class IV for restricted-access sites with trained supervision. The class is not a marketing tier, it describes the duty the unit is built to withstand. We select the class from how the gate is genuinely used rather than from the type of building it happens to stand in front of.

Swing, Slide and Cantilever Operators

The mechanism follows the gate type. Swing gates take arm or articulated-arm operators, or underground units where the installation must be invisible. Slide and cantilever gates take rack-driven or chain-driven operators sized to the leaf length and weight. Each has its own failure mode, and we specify for it: arm operators put concentrated load into the hinge post, while rack-driven units depend on the rack staying properly aligned to the pinion along the whole run.

Solar Operators and Battery Backup

Where a mains supply would mean trenching a long driveway, a solar operator with battery backup is frequently both cheaper and simpler. The specification that matters is not the operator but the panel and battery, sized to the daily cycle count and to the worst realistic run of overcast days rather than to an average. Battery backup is also worth specifying on mains-powered gates, particularly community and commercial installations where an outage otherwise strands vehicles.

Safety, Standards and Compliance

UL 325 Monitored Entrapment Protection

An automatic vehicular gate requires two independent means of entrapment protection, and current operators monitor those devices continuously, refusing to run if one fails or is disconnected. That behaviour is deliberate and it is the single most important safety feature on the machine. We install monitored photo eyes and safety edges to the operator’s monitored inputs, and where a nuisance fault keeps recurring we find and fix its cause rather than bridging the input out to stop the complaint.

ASTM F2200 and the Gate Itself

Most entrapment incidents involve the gate rather than the operator: a gap that closes as the leaf travels, an exposed roller, a picket passing close to a fixed post. ASTM F2200 addresses exactly those construction details, and it applies whether the gate is new or is an existing one being automated. We assess an existing leaf against it before quoting automation and include any screening, guarding or edge protection the standard calls for in the written scope.

Loop Detection and Vehicle Sensing

Inductive loops cut into the driveway do three distinct jobs. An exit loop opens the gate for a vehicle leaving, a safety loop holds it open while a vehicle is beneath it, and a shadow loop prevents closure onto a vehicle stopped in the opening. Gates that close on cars are usually missing the second or third. We saw-cut and seal loops into the surface rather than surface-mounting them, since a proud loop is destroyed by tire traffic within weeks.

Emergency Services Access

A gated driveway that fire apparatus may need to enter requires an approved means of access, normally a Knox box or a fire department key switch wired to the operator, driven by California Fire Code fire apparatus access road requirements. This is agreed with the authority having jurisdiction and designed in from the start. Retrofitting it after an inspection failure costs several times what including it would have, and it is one of the easiest items to settle early.

Our Step-by-Step Automation Process

Assess the Gate and the Opening

We check the leaf for square and rigidity, the hinges and footings for wear and movement, the driveway for slope and crown, and the site for available power. Where the gate needs work before it can be driven, that comes first and is priced separately.

Specify and Approve

You get the operator selection, its UL 325 class, the safety devices and the access hardware in a written proposal before anything is ordered, along with what we found on the existing gate. Anything we identified but were not asked to address is listed separately, so nothing on that list proceeds without your agreement.

Install, Wire and Commission

Conduit and cabling go in, the operator is mounted and aligned, safety devices are installed to the monitored inputs, and loops are cut and sealed. The gate is then run through its full travel under load with every safety device tested rather than assumed working.

Handover and Follow-Up

You receive a written handover covering opener programming, remote pairing and the manual release. We return once the gate has settled to re-level hinges and re-tension hardware, because a newly automated gate beds in over its first weeks.

How do you decide which operator my gate needs?

From the leaf, not the opening. We weigh or calculate the leaf, measure its width, and establish how many cycles it will run in a typical day, then select an operator whose duty rating covers that with margin. We also match the UL 325 class to the application, since a Class I residential unit and a Class III commercial unit are built to different expectations. Width alone is the number most quotes use and it is not sufficient.

Can my existing gate be automated?

Usually, once it has been assessed. The leaf has to be square and rigid, the hinges and footings sound, and the construction has to meet ASTM F2200, which addresses pinch and shear points a hand-operated gate never had to consider. Where the leaf has sagged we rebuild the hinge stile or add a diagonal brace first, because fitting a motor to a gate that already drags simply transfers the resistance into the operator.

What safety equipment is legally required?

UL 325 requires two independent means of entrapment protection on an automatic vehicular gate, and modern operators monitor those devices and refuse to run if one is faulted or disconnected. In practice that usually means photo eyes plus a safety edge, often supplemented by inductive loops. The gate itself must also be built to ASTM F2200. We install the devices to the operator's monitored inputs rather than bridging them out.

Is a solar gate operator a real option or a compromise?

It is a genuine option when it is sized properly. The panel and battery have to be matched to the daily cycle count rather than to the operator's badge rating, because a gate cycling forty times a day stores and spends far more energy than one cycling six. Undersized solar is the reason these systems get a poor reputation. Where a mains run would mean trenching a long driveway, correctly sized solar is usually cheaper and just as reliable.

What happens if the power goes out?

Every operator has a manual release that disengages the drive so the leaf can be moved by hand, and its location and operation are covered in the written handover rather than left for you to find. Operators specified with battery backup will continue to cycle through an outage for a period set by battery capacity. On community and commercial gates we generally treat backup as standard rather than optional.

Do I need a permit to automate a gate in Bellflower?

Automation itself is not what triggers the zoning question; height is. Under section 17.72.060(D) anything over six feet, and anything above 42 inches in the front area, requires Planning Director approval. Electrical work to supply the operator is a separate consideration. We establish at design stage what your specific installation requires so it is settled before fabrication rather than at inspection.

How often does an automatic gate need servicing?

It depends almost entirely on cycle count, which is why we ask about it at specification. A residential gate cycling a handful of times a day needs little beyond periodic hinge greasing and a safety device check. A commercial gate running continuously wears rollers, chain and hinge pins on a predictable schedule, and servicing those before they fail is considerably cheaper than the emergency call when they do.
